Germany Teen Paatz Making F1 Academy Debut in Montreal as Wild-Card Entry

Summary by Sportsnet
Most 16-year-olds are just starting to think about getting their driver’s license, but Mathilda Paatz is no ordinary 16-year-old. Paatz is racing this weekend at Montreal’s Circuit Gilles Villeneuve in F1 Academy, the female-only development series. The German teen is making her series debut this weekend as a wild-card entry thanks to a sponsorship deal with Gatorade.
